Pizza Pasta Bake Recipe

Ingredients:

1 med. green bell pepper, chopped
1 med. onion, chopped
1 c. sliced mushrooms
1 Tbls. vegetable oil
¼ c. sliced ripe olives
½ tsp. Lawrey's garlic powder with parsley or garlic salt
1 pkg. Lawrey's original-style spaghetti sauce spices & seasonings
1 ¾ c. water
1 can tomato paste
¾ c. grated mozzarella cheese
10 oz. mostaccioli, cooked & drained
3 oz. thinly sliced pepperoni

Directions:

Saute bell pepper, onion, mushrooms and garlic salt in vegetable oil until tender. Stir in spaghetti, spices, water and tomato paste. Bring to a boil, reduce heart & simmer 10 minutes. Add mostaccioli, pepperoni & olives. Blend well. Pour into 12 x 8 casserole dish. Top with cheese and bake in a 350 degree oven for 15 minutes or until cheese melts.
